The red alga Kappaphycus alvarezii is a rich source of bioactive compounds with potential applications in the cosmetic industry. This study aimed to characterize a cosmetic serum containing K. alvarezii and evaluate its immediate moisturizing effect on the skin. A randomized, triple-blind, parallel-group clinical trial was conducted with 28 healthy participants, allocated 1:1 to receive either a control formulation with hyaluronic acid or a test formulation with K. alvarezii. The formulations were assessed for stability over 60 days using organoleptic, microbiological, pH, and rheological analyses.
